Canon EOS 90D at a glance:

  • 32.5MP APS-C CMOS Sensor
  • DIGIC 8 Image Processor
  • UHD 4K30p & Full HD 120p Video Recording
  • 3″ 1.04m-Dot Vari-Angle Touchscreen LCD
  • 45-Point All Cross-Type AF System
  • Dual Pixel CMOS AF with 5481 AF Points
  • Up to 10-fps Shooting, ISO 100-25600
  • Built-In Wi-Fi and Bluetooth
  • EOS iTR AF, Electronic Shutter Function
  • 220,000-Pixel AE Metering Sensor

ePHOTOzine reviewed the new Canon EOS 90D, Canon’s latest APS-C DSLR.

They gave the EOS 90D a “highly recommended” rating. As usual wirh Canon cameras, high image quality and color reproduction are emphasised. From the conclusion:

If you’re looking for a Digital SLR, then the Canon EOS 90D gives a range of compelling features, that make it a great choice. As a DSLR, rather than a mirrorless camera, it also offers exceptional battery life, with 1300 shots possible before the battery is depleted. The ability to focus on a subjects face, while using the optical viewfinder, is incredibly useful for portraits. In-camera raw editing is easy to use and can produce some great results.

[…] From the outside the EOS 90D may look just like every other Canon DSLR, with a conservative design, but inside is where the most of the differences can be found. Canon has developed a new 32mp APS-C CMOS sensor, yet don’t seem to have been massively hit by increased noise, when compared to other Canon DSLRs. It offers a higher resolution sensor than others, and the 4K video using the full width of the sensor will be a massive positive for many.

Let’s go for another compare-apples-to-pears post.

It seems the iPhone 11 inspires people to compare it to professional and much more expensive photographic gear. After a comparison with the Canon EOS 5D Mark IV, here is another user, Josh Rossi, better known as Photoshop Dad, who compares his medium format Fujifilm GFX 100 to the iPhone 11.

He writes:

In this video, I’ll be comparing the iPhone 11 Pro with the Fujifilm GFX 100. The Fuji medium format camera costs right around $13,000 with the body and lens and is one of the best cameras out there today. The sensor size alone is 1/3 the size of the entire iPhone 11 just for comparison.

Initially, I didn’t want to even compare the two because I thought that the GFX was going to win by a long shot. I was totally surprised when I did the comparison and saw the results on the computer. Even though the more expensive camera obviously wins this battle, the iPhone 11 Pro gave surprising results especially if the viewer isn’t zooming in super close to the image.

I got really excited about it and decided to try and recreate a movie poster. I’ve wanted to do this test for years but Apple’s technology wasn’t up to par yet. Once again I was surprised at the results that were created. I think that the image quality of the iPhone is good enough to print on a billboard, post on social media and even use on big campaigns.
